
Paint fumes can cause a range of health issues, from short-term irritation to eyes, nose, and throat, to more serious long-term problems like respiratory issues, kidney damage, and even central nervous system damage. This is due to the volatile organic compounds (VOCs) found in paint, which can be toxic. As such, toxicity is another term that could be used to describe the adverse effects of exposure to paint fumes. To minimize the risks associated with paint fumes, it is important to ensure proper ventilation, wear protective gear, and choose paints with lower VOC levels.

Short-term exposure to paint fumes can cause headaches, dizziness, nausea, and eye, nose, and throat irritation
Inhaling paint fumes can be harmful to health, as they often contain volatile organic compounds (VOCs) and other toxic substances. Short-term exposure to paint fumes can cause a range of adverse effects, including headaches, dizziness, nausea, and irritation of the eyes, nose, and throat.
Headaches are a common symptom of short-term exposure to paint fumes, resulting from the irritation of the brain caused by the chemicals in the paint. Dizziness is another frequently experienced side effect, occurring due to altered oxygen levels in the blood. This can be addressed by stepping outside to breathe fresh air and seeking immediate medical attention if symptoms persist.
Nausea is also a common reaction to short-term paint fume exposure, arising from the impact of VOCs on the digestive system. It is crucial to monitor for signs of stomach upset, such as vomiting or diarrhea, and seek appropriate medical advice if necessary.
Additionally, paint fumes can irritate the eyes, causing eye-watering and discomfort. Rinsing the eyes with running water for 15 to 20 minutes can provide relief. If pain or vision problems occur, it is essential to seek medical attention promptly.
The nose and throat are also susceptible to irritation from paint fumes. This irritation typically subsides when exposed to fresh air or by taking a warm shower to eliminate any lingering fumes. However, in some cases, strong paint fumes can trigger allergic reactions and exacerbate conditions such as asthma, eczema, and rhinitis.
To mitigate the risks associated with short-term paint fume exposure, it is advisable to prioritize ventilation when painting. This includes ventilating the area before starting work and utilizing fans to direct airflow outdoors. Working outdoors is preferable to minimize indoor air quality issues. Additionally, selecting paints with lower VOC levels, such as water-based or low-VOC options, can reduce potential health risks.

Long-term exposure to paint fumes can cause liver damage, kidney damage, and neurological issues
Inhaling paint fumes can be harmful to health, as they often contain volatile organic compounds (VOCs) and other toxic substances. While short-term exposure to paint fumes can cause headaches, dizziness, nausea, and irritation of the eyes, nose, and throat, long-term exposure can have much more severe health consequences.
Indeed, long-term exposure to paint fumes can lead to chronic respiratory issues, neurological issues, and an increased risk of cancer due to certain chemicals. For instance, exposure to chemicals like toluene can impact brain function, leading to memory loss or cognitive decline. Furthermore, certain chemicals found in paints, such as benzene, have been linked to an increased risk of developing certain cancers.
In addition to respiratory and neurological issues, and an increased cancer risk, long-term exposure to paint fumes can also cause kidney damage and liver damage. For example, a study on automobile artisans in Lagos, Nigeria, found that chronic exposure to paint fumes may impair renal and liver function and induce oxidative stress and toxicity.
To minimize the risks associated with paint fumes, it is important to implement proper ventilation techniques, wear protective gear, such as respirator masks, and take breaks to reduce exposure during painting projects. It is also recommended to explore low-VOC and natural paint options to reduce harmful fume exposure while maintaining a quality finish.

Pregnant people should avoid inhaling paint fumes as it may increase the risk of macrosomia
Inhalation of paint fumes can cause irritation to the skin, eyes, nose and throat. It can also lead to more serious health issues like respiratory problems, kidney damage and central nervous system damage. Therefore, it is advised that one minimises exposure to paint fumes.
Pregnant people should take extra care to avoid inhaling paint fumes as studies have shown that there are serious risks associated with exposure to these fumes, especially in the second and third trimesters. Exposure to paint fumes during pregnancy can increase the risk of miscarriage and birth defects. Research has also shown that pregnant women exposed to paint fumes are more likely to have babies with brain damage, heart defects and other serious health issues.
A 2017 study found that exposure to paint fumes in the six months prior to conception can impact a baby's birth weight and increase the risk of macrosomia. Another study, published in 2019, concluded that home renovations were "significantly associated with male genital abnormality".
Given the potential risks, pregnant people should avoid inhaling paint fumes as much as possible. If painting is necessary, it is recommended to use low-VOC or zero-VOC paints, ensure good ventilation in the area, and wear a mask over the nose and mouth.

VOCs in paint fumes can cause short-term and long-term health issues
Volatile organic compounds (VOCs) are gases emitted by certain solids or liquids, including paint. They can cause short-term and long-term health issues, especially in poorly ventilated areas.
Short-term exposure to VOCs in paint fumes can lead to immediate effects such as headaches, dizziness, nausea, and respiratory problems. These symptoms can often be alleviated by stepping outside for fresh air.
Prolonged or repeated exposure to paint fumes can lead to more serious health issues, including long-term damage to certain systems of the body. Respiratory issues such as asthma or bronchitis may develop, along with neurological problems and an increased risk of cancer due to exposure to certain chemicals like benzene and formaldehyde.
To minimize the risks associated with VOCs in paint fumes, it is important to take safety measures such as selecting paints with lower VOC levels, ensuring proper ventilation, and wearing protective gear like respirator masks, gloves, goggles, and coveralls. Low-VOC and no-VOC paint options are available and can reduce exposure to harmful chemicals.
Additionally, it is important to allow for adequate drying time and to avoid entering a freshly painted room for at least two to three days. During this period, it is recommended to keep windows open and consider using fans to direct airflow outside, helping to dissipate the paint fumes.

Minimising exposure to paint fumes involves using protective gear, ventilating the area, and choosing low-VOC paints
Inhalation of paint fumes can cause various health issues, from short-term irritation to the eyes, nose, and throat to more severe long-term effects like respiratory problems, kidney damage, and central nervous system damage. To minimise exposure to paint fumes, it is essential to take several precautions, including the use of protective gear, ensuring adequate ventilation, and opting for low-VOC paints.
Protective gear plays a vital role in creating a barrier between the skin and paint fumes. When working with paint, it is recommended to wear an N95 respirator mask, which effectively filters out paint fumes. Chemical-resistant gloves made of nitrile or latex shield the skin from irritation and absorption. Safety goggles protect the eyes from splashes and irritation, while disposable coveralls prevent paint from coming into contact with clothing, making cleanup easier.
Ventilating the area is another crucial step in minimising paint fume exposure. Before beginning any painting project, it is essential to ventilate the space for at least 30 minutes, especially if strong odours are present. During and after painting, keep windows open and consider using electric fans to direct airflow outside. For indoor painting, it is advisable to opt for water-based paints, which generally produce lower levels of chemical vapours and VOCs.
Choosing low-VOC paints is an effective strategy to reduce exposure to harmful fumes. VOCs, or volatile organic compounds, are released into the air as gases and can pose health risks when inhaled. By selecting paints with lower VOC levels, you can minimise the concentration of harmful chemicals in the air. Reading paint labels is essential to understanding the specific chemicals and their potential health effects.
Additionally, it is important to be mindful of the potential risks associated with paint fumes, especially for vulnerable individuals such as children, the elderly, and those with breathing conditions. Taking breaks and stepping outside for fresh air can provide immediate relief from paint fume exposure. Properly disposing of leftover paint and ensuring closed containers are tightly sealed are also important considerations to minimise fumes and accidental ingestion.
By prioritising protective gear, adequate ventilation, and low-VOC paints, you can effectively minimise exposure to paint fumes and create a safer environment for yourself and others.
